LINUX.ORG.RU

Программа для бухгалтерии в виде расширения Firefox

 add-on, , бухучет,


3

2

Интерактивный Клиент ГЛОБУС предназначен для ведения мелкого и частного бизнеса. Несетевой, однопользовательский. Создан как оболочка для собственных расширений (модулей). Пока работает одно расширение — Документы, которое позволяет создавать и редактировать документы на базе шаблонов и ведет справочники корреспондентов, наименований товара-услуг. Формат документа — HTML. Сам документ является шаблоном. Хранение данных осуществляется в виде сжатого JSON.

>>> Подробности



Проверено: Shaman007 ()
Последнее исправление: Shaman007 (всего исправлений: 4)

Всегда мечтал, чтобы булгактер насчитал мне зарплату в файрфоксе!

anonymous
()

Может, начнём постить новости вроде «Новая качалка с вконтакта для ондроед!»
А что, тоже полезная штука, и линукс там более причастен, чем тут.

mittorn ★★★★★
()

В чём смысл этой разработки? Показать, что на XUL можно делать полноценные программы?

Не будет ли здесь по сравнению с традиционными тулкитами больше тормозов и всяких капризностей типа привязки корректной работы к версии FF?

hobbit ★★★★★
()
Ответ на: комментарий от hobbit

Смысл: 1. Как обычно, для себя ничего подходящего не нашел ни под линуксом ни под виндой. А по работе частенько приходилось слышать просьбы дать «простенькую» программу чтобы накладные печатать. Вот написал. Сейчас жена - бухгалтер ведет в одном экземпляре программы четыре конторы.

2. 10 лет назад была написана система управления и бухучета (включая зарплату) в качестве клиента используется 20 подобных XUL клиентов. Работает до сих пор и очень шустро, ворочает оперативными данными примерно 1 гиг, и около 5 в архиве. Никаких тормозов нет. Проблем отвязки от версий FF тоже не наблюдалась. 3. У себя испытал на базе 100 000 документов около 120 метров. Никаких тормозов. Ну разве что на сортировку уходит чуть больше секунды.

Globusik
() автор топика
Ответ на: комментарий от Globusik

Эмм... сформулирую близкий вопрос более субъективно :)

Что привлекло автора программы в разработке именно на XUL по сравнению с более традиционными средствами кроссплатформенного программирования (Qt, GTK+, Java, наконец)? Есть какие-то преимущества? Или просто «что знал, на том и написал» (это тоже аргумент)?

hobbit ★★★★★
()
Ответ на: комментарий от hobbit

Ну очевидно же, что xul, это xml+javascript.

Подобные динамические средства разработки на «Qt, GTK+, Java, наконец» появились не так давно. Уж никак не 10 лет назад.

Ставить программу с gtk и qt куда сложнее и геморней, чем файрфокс + расширение, для которого есть удобный менеджер.

Да, интерфейс тормозней и возмжностей в опенгл меньше, но ведь это и не требуется в бухгалтерии.

На мой взгляд, выбор автора вполне понятен и обладает очевидными перимуществами. Наверняка есть и подводные камни типа хоткеев или проблем печатью, но это ему лучше знать...

AVL2 ★★★★★
()

Напомнило игру На ВБА в экселе

DeadEye ★★★★★
()

Хотя это самопиар. Лучше в толксы это. Имхо, было бы правильнее.

DeadEye ★★★★★
()
Ответ на: комментарий от hobbit

Скорость разработки и практически полная аутентичность для винды и линукса.

Globusik
() автор топика
Ответ на: комментарий от AVL2

XUL, HTML, XBL, CSS, JS, а теперь еще и JSON для хранения данных. Это же все в одном флаконе. Начинал уже node и MongoDB подтягивать чтобы делать многопользовательский вариант. Пока отложил.

Одновременно с отладкой интерклиента, я делал к нему модуль для администрирования удаленной СУБД. Меня друг попросил сделать систему для учета ж.д вагонов и их ремонта. Нужно было вести паспортизацию всего парка около 500 вагонов. Плюс разадчу заданий на ремонт и их отслеживание. В результате получилась такая штука. Сервер с СУБД у меня дома на линуксе. Друг у себя на работе с винды с помощью моего глобуса и модуля к нему раздает задания на ремонт. Эти задания смс-кой раздаются на смартфоны исполнителей. Те в свою очередь видят свои задания через http на моем сервере и через него же отчитываются. Все это было собрано довольно быстро.

Globusik
() автор топика
Ответ на: комментарий от Globusik

Но вот и минус вылез. Расширение Документы не захотело ставиться на файрфокс 25. На 30 встало.

AVL2 ★★★★★
()

Скоро шутка про emacs и редактор будет не актуальной, а актуальной станет про firefox и браузер :)

h4tr3d ★★★★★
()

Пожалуй, предвосхищу события и, предвидя грядущую популярность подобных решений, заранее напишу «РЕШЕТО!»

WARNING ★★★★
()
Ответ на: комментарий от WARNING

В принципе согласен. Будем бороться. Средства есть.

Globusik
() автор топика

Начало

Кроссплатформенность и отсутствие необходимости устанавливать дополнительное ПО (Firefox не в счет) - это плюсы. Скорость - тоже плюс.

Отсутствуют связи данных, но, похоже, что на то и расчет был. Нет классической базы данных - нет перспективы вырасти во что-то более серьезное, чем «набивалка документиков для печати».

Интерфейс местами неоднозначен, местами просто не работает. Пример: при первом открытии меню «Настройки» окно оказалось сплюснутым по вертикали так, что я не увидел формы редактирования. Никакой подсказки, что внизу что-то спряталось нет. В списке регионов не работает прокрутка ползунком. В документах при выборе типа я не вижу никаких подвтерждений/оповещений, что тип документа выбран успешно - пользователь ждет ответной реакции на действия, иначе он начинает сомневаться в работоспособности программного кода.

В общем и целом задача ввода и печати документов решена давно: Linux + «Бизнес пак»

Ваше преимущество в том, что на базе «Клиент ГЛОБУС» каждый может (если знает как) сотворить что-то свое. Но пока это выглядит очень «неготовым» приложением к рекламе какого-то оружейного завода.

MageWarrior
()
Ответ на: Начало от MageWarrior

нет перспективы вырасти во что-то более серьезное

надо же, ls (cd,mkdir & etc) так и не выросли, несмотря на вопли ЛОРа...

p01ymer
()
Ответ на: комментарий от static_lab

А что пояснять? Этому место в Desktop, а не в новостях Mozilla

Valkeru ★★★★
()

Круто, жги!

Ещё бы что-нибудь для домохозяйств было - вообще было бы зашибись.

Hoodoo ★★★★★
()
Ответ на: комментарий от Hoodoo

Ещё бы что-нибудь для домохозяйств было - вообще было бы зашибись.

Например? Учет поголовья или коэффициет усушки? :)

Globusik
() автор топика
Ответ на: Начало от MageWarrior

Спасибо. На счет сплюснутости по вертикали не замечал у себя. Буду гонять. На счет прокрутки ползунком в курсе. В других местах работает. Тип документа это такой же атрибут как номер или дата. Что тут нужно подтверждать? Бизнес-пак не устраивает категорически. На счет «каждого» совершенно верно. Но сами понимаете, выкладывать описание API пока рано.

Это не оружейный завод. Это мой «стратегический партнер» ООО «Ижевские ружья». Для них десять лет назад была создана система управления в которой в качестве клиента используется решение подобное ГЛОБУС'у.

Globusik
() автор топика

Ещё лет 5 назад, если не больше, использовал Бизнес-Пак под wine без малейших нареканий.

MumiyTroll ★★★
()

Посмотрел сайт проекта...

... и понял, что его нужно реально дорабатывать.
Описание какое-то... беспомощное, сюда бы литератора, чтобы более образным языком выдал, а не техническо-кулуарно-разговорным. Я уже молчу, что перед словом «это» везде отсутствует тире, где нужно («ГЛОБУС это помощник» и т.п.).
Далее, в разделе «Контакт» я хочу увидеть реальные контакты (мыло, сайт автора), а не форму обратной связи, которая у большинства создаёт впечатление «звони, звони, только колокол не разбей».
Я бы вообще для солидности заменил этот пункт другим типа «Об авторе».

UPD: и замените, в конце концов, шрифт подзаголовка! Это ж страх господень.

Steplton ★★★★★
()
Последнее исправление: Steplton (всего исправлений: 1)
Ответ на: Посмотрел сайт проекта... от Steplton

Далее, в разделе «Контакт» я хочу увидеть реальные контакты (мыло, сайт автора), а не форму обратной связи, которая у большинства создаёт впечатление «звони, звони, только колокол не разбей».

Ну, не знаю. У меня такая же форма. И я всегда отвечаю, если это только не предложения о покупке сайта, размещения тизеров и т.п. ))

vovans ★★★★★
()
Ответ на: комментарий от Globusik

Firefox 10.0.11

Расширение Глобус ИК не может быть установлено, так как оно не совместимо с Firefox 10.0.11 Вот так вот. Что там у нас 10 лет назад было? Firefox 1.0?

seyko2
()
Ответ на: Firefox 10.0.11 от seyko2

Не помню какой там был фокс. А что?

Globusik
() автор топика
Ответ на: комментарий от Globusik

Вам бы свою историю успеха в новость запилить. Это ведь очень ценно когда есть успешное внедрение, а то вы себя совсем не рекламируете.

A-234 ★★★★★
()

Лично мне нафиг не нужно, но уважаю все равно.
«Паравоз» со скрина с главной страницы взорвал мозг.

thesis ★★★★★
()

1. Где репозиторий с исходниками?

2. Не увидел в install.rdf строки с updateURL. Как обновлять собираешься?

3. Первый раз вижу такую запись:

<em:creator>A.Koulikov, Izhevsk, 2014</em:creator>

Можешь пояснить откуда ты её взял?

4.

Нам нужно установить два расширения для Firefox

В одном пакете смотрелись бы логичнее.

А в целом, удачи в начинанях. Сейчас всё выглядит весьма сыровато.

d2
()

Больно это напоминает r2d2 от Ю.Хныкина из ИТК. Он тоже Ижевским ружьям делал что-то.

UPD: А-а-а, Куликов... Знакомые всё лица.

Skull ★★★★★
()
Последнее исправление: Skull (всего исправлений: 1)

Так, а исходники где? Если это реклама очередного проприетарного говна, то что оно делает в разделе мозилла?

anonymous
()
Ответ на: комментарий от d2

Когда будет готово описание API для расширений выложу на гитхабе все исходники. Сейчас они внутри пакета. Можете ковыряться. Сперва хотел обновлять с официального сайта аддонов мозиллы. Но там проверка очень долго идет. Сейчас как раз делаю систему обновлений со своего сайта. В одном пакете расширения нельзя. Кому-то печать документов не нужна будет. Запись с упоминанием года, это по закону об авторском праве. Нужно указывать со знаком копирайта имя или псевдоним автора год и место первой публикации.

Globusik
() автор топика
Ответ на: комментарий от Skull

Из r2d2 и родилось. В ружьях все прекрасно работает. Там сейчас два помощника работают, Всетаки 30 рабочих мест. Только два под виндой. Плюс свой сайт сами тащат. С нашей базы данные идут в интермагазин.

Globusik
() автор топика
Ответ на: комментарий от Globusik

Из r2d2 и родилось. В ружьях все прекрасно работает. Там сейчас два помощника работают, Всетаки 30 рабочих мест. Только два под виндой. Плюс свой сайт сами тащат. С нашей базы данные идут в интермагазин.

Молодцы. Жаль, CLIP сдох.

Skull ★★★★★
()
Ответ на: комментарий от Skull

Да не совсем сдох. Работает кое где. Поддержки нет. Развития. А на это интузиазма уже не хватает. Сам понимаешь.

Globusik
() автор топика
Ответ на: комментарий от Globusik

Да не совсем сдох. Работает кое где. Поддержки нет. Развития. А на это интузиазма уже не хватает. Сам понимаешь.

Понимаю. Куда Хныкин-то делся?

Skull ★★★★★
()
Ответ на: комментарий от Skull

Вчера обсуждали с ним на предмет рыбалки. :) Подробности не буду, ибо оффтоп. Мы с ним как раз и делали задачу по ремонту вагонов. Как всегда на энтузиазме. Много чего я в жизни писал, но это конфетка получилась. И главное вписалась в глобус, как родная встала. На сайте как нибудь описание выложу, может кому-то еще нужна будет. У вас как? Смирнову привет, если Ижевск еще помнит.

Globusik
() автор топика
Ответ на: комментарий от Globusik

Паровоз

Нужда в мобильном приложении была давно. Специфика работы в том что территория большая и связь слабая.На ижевском участке Ржд по ремонту вагонов Глобус реально работает как на стационарных компах так и на смартфонах. Причем тырнет слабенький через DSL по корпоративной лапше. А сервер если кто не понял - стоит уавтора дома. И ничего. Глобус справляется. Поскольку информация служебная - увы ссылочку на пробу дать не могу. Разве что скриншоты со смартфона.

lox
()
Ответ на: комментарий от Skull

Замена CLIP'у, RAD для бизнеса

Skull, Globusik и другие строители (любители) бизнес-софта. Почему на линуксе после долгих потуг так и не вышло ничего значимого? Как вы в этом ракурсе смотрите на среду быстрой разработки Lazarus? Спасибо!

step7
()
Ответ на: Замена CLIP'у, RAD для бизнеса от step7

Как это не вышло? Нативная версия 1C:Предприятие, warehouseopen, openerp. Это не мало и на любой вкус. Более того есть реальные работающие решения и люди, их поддерживающие.

А специфический софт можно разрабатывать только под заказ, иначе не будет ни нормальной постановки задачи, ни финансирования, ни поддержки. Сам через это прошёл.

Skull ★★★★★
()
Ответ на: Замена CLIP'у, RAD для бизнеса от step7

Если Вы имеете в виду «стоящее» именно бизнес-софт, то если это будет работающее только под линукс, то встаньте на место потенциального пользователя. Его в первую очередь занимает вопрос чтобы работало. А когда ему предлагают софт, который еще неизвестно как будет работать и при этом ставят условие что он будет работать только под линукс, то зачем ему это надо. Поэтому если «потуги» были на создание именно бизнес-софта только под линукс, то они изначально были проигрышными. А когда у нас появились более-менее рабочие инструменты для создания кросс-платформных приложений?

Самое главное, я считаю, дело сейчас даже не в кросс-платформности, благо инструменты уже есть. Дело в насыщенности одинэсом, который кстати уже стал кросс-платформным. Отстутствует потребность которую требовалось бы решить продуктом которого нет. Нужно найти эту потребность. Делов то. :)

Есть еще много причин, которые относятся не просто к бизнес-софту. А вообще к созданию «стоящего». Сейчас очень много появилось продуктов, включая облака. Главная проблема - отсутствие серьезной системной проработки над продуктом. Это очень длинная тема, поэтому здесь не буду об этом.

Globusik
() автор топика
Ответ на: комментарий от Globusik

Перво-наперво имел ввиду крах проектов Ананас (а-ля 1С) и CLIP (реинкарнации Клиппера). Ведь на базе FoxPro и Clipper'а в конце 90-х было неимоверное количество решений бизнес процессов на любой цвет и вкус. Нишу заполнила 1С? Возможно. Но я почему-то был уверен, что RAD -системы взамен устаревающих fox'a и clip'a обязательно будут жить. Ведь далеко не всем нужны «Управляемые приложения», ERP, CRM и прочая маркетинговая галиматья. Мелкому бизнесу до сих пор требуется простая без лишних одинэсовских сущностей программа расчета заработной платы с формированием отчетности, складской софт, учет первичных документов и формирования бухгалтерских проводок включая аналитику по счетам. Для этих предприятий возможности корпоративных решений на все случаи жизни избыточны. 1С в большинстве предприятий используется в таком же объеме как и Microsoft Office среднестатистической секретаршей... На счет RAD (быстрой среды разработки небольшого прикладного софта), именно в Lazarus'е вижу наследника фокса и клиппера. Другие решения, включая web-софт, на проектирование и программирование отнимает куда большее время. Вот решенная вами прикладная задача на XUL решается на том же Lazarus'е довольно оперативно и просто... Или я чего-то не знаю? )))

step7
()
Ответ на: комментарий от Skull

На счет Паскаля, вы имеет ввиду уход от десктоп-приложений к web? Тут как бы сам однозначно определиться не могу, периодически пишу приложения под «паутину» на утилитарном PHP+SQLite (иногда MySQL), но это требует больше трудозатрат.

step7
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.